Club History

The inaugural meeting of the club was held on the 5th May 1994, at which time the club was named “T. S. Wrekin Sub-Aqua Club”. One of the original aims of the club was to provide support for the Telford sea cadet diving section. “T S” standing for Training Ship.

 

The club became a member of the Sub-Aqua Association, number 829, and commenced its weekly pool session on the 1st July 1994 at Newport pool where the club has continued to meet until November 2021 when major work commenced to improve the carbon footprint of the building. Part of this work reduced the maximum depth from 2.7 metres to 1.5 metres. This reduced depth meant that scuba training could not be effectively undertaken, and the club moved to the Short Wood swimming pool in Wellington in January 2022.

 

At a meeting on the 4th October 1996 the club changed its name to the “Aquarius Sub-Aqua club” and the Sea Cadet diving section continued in its own right as a junior branch of the British Sub Aqua Club (BSAC) with its own Diving Officer and committee.  Whilst no longer part of our club the sea cadets have continued to use the clubs pool sessions in what is seen as a special relationship between the two clubs.

 

The club aims continues to be to organise diving for its members and to provide newer and less experienced members with training and guidance in line with the SAA’s guide lines.
